XEL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

980 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Xcel Energy (XEL)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$23.3B — down 14% from $27.3B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 136 funds closed out of XEL and 109 opened new positions — a net loss of 27 holders — while 378 trimmed existing stakes and 330 added.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$382M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Investment Management, cutting an estimated $944M.
